自从Excel网络函数库发布以来,深受广大表哥表姐的喜爱,尤其是谷歌的批量翻译函数,显著提高了翻译效率,备受电商朋友们推崇。然而美中不足的是借助Excel浏览器实现谷歌翻译多少有点技术难度,初次使用需要耗费点脑细胞,这可难为了不少朋友。虽然困难比较多,但只要思想不滑坡,办法总比困难多,今天我给大家介绍一个自动更新翻译结果的技巧。
以前
翻译的步骤是先在Excel中写好翻译公式,将翻译请求加入队列;然后启动Excel浏览器执行翻译任务;当Excel浏览器翻译完成后,再回到Excel中刷新公式获得结果。
现在
翻译的步骤是先在Excel中写好翻译公式,将翻译请求加入队列;然后点击自动更新按钮;启动Excel浏览器执行翻译任务。此时Excel浏览器翻译多少,Excel中会自动显示翻译的结果,不需要人工再去不断刷新公式。
基本原理
通过VBA代码每隔5秒钟自动检查已经加入队列但未翻译完成的结果。
使用方法
从Excel网络函数库官网www.excelapi.com下载名称为“ Excel网络函数库翻译工具.xlsm”的翻译模板。
打开模板,书写翻译公式,将翻译请求加入队列,然后点击自动更新按钮。
为了演示方便,这里使用 BaiduFanyiByWebBrowser() 函数,因为这个函数不是批量翻译,可以看到演示效果,如下图所示。
每次刷新时,会检查返回值为“加入队列...”和“正在取值...”公式,当全部翻译完成后,会自动停止更新。如果翻译数量比较大,那么每次刷新等待时间可能会比较长,建议按照实际情况使用该方法。
修改时间间隔
翻译模板默认每隔5秒刷新一次公式,如果不合适,可以自己修改。打开VBA编辑器,找到模块1中的StartTimer()代码,修改TimeValue中的数值。例如改成间隔6秒,可修改为TimeValue("00:00:06")
常见问题
点击“自动更新”按钮时,如果出现宏被禁用的警告,如下所示
此时,需要设置宏的安全性,启用全部宏,如下所示
如果需要在WPS下使用,请为WPS安装VBA组件。
使用Excel网络函数库的翻译函数,需要具备一定Excel基础,Excel作为职场最常用的办公软件,值得我们花精力学习,如果您遇到技术问题,可以向我们反馈。
关注我们,获得更多IT小工具↓
往期回顾:
在Excel中如何实现人民币大写金额
HR小伙伴周末推荐,如何在Excel中建立生日提醒?
官宣-我是计算机高手!
Excel 批量添加图片的神器来了!
Excel中如何筛选合并单元格
菜鸟裹裹查询接口重新上线啦
如何在Excel中查询币种汇率
如何用Excel抓取网页数据
如何借助Excel浏览器、菜鸟裹裹批量查询快递信息
如何在Excel中使用快递鸟批量查询快递单信息
Excel“减肥”有妙招
如何在Excel中批量查询快递单信息
如何在Excel中查询币种汇率
如何在Excel中批量查看股票价格
Excel 分割字符串
在Excel中如何删除图片背景
Excel快递查询函数大全
ExcelAPI网络函数库目录第一期
WPS用户福利来了
期盼已久的顺丰快递查询上线了
且看"高手"如何用Excel做电子发票台账-上
且看"高手"如何用Excel做电子发票台账-下
如何用一个函数搞定考勤打卡记录
如何用Excel检查两个文本之间相似程度
IP地址归属地批量查询
如何在Excel中绘制地图
如何在Excel中计算CPK和PPK的值
如何突破快递查询限制
Excel实用技巧之高级随机函数
Excel网络函数库接入顺丰新接口
如何在Excel表格中批量添加网络图片